Type : Jeton Cu 33, Société académique de Blois
Date: (1860-1879)
Date: n.d.
Metal : copper
Diameter : 33 mm
Orientation dies : 12 h.
Weight : 15,19 g.
Edge : lisse
Puncheon : (abeille) CUIVRE
Coments on the condition:
Exemplaire superbe, patine marron

Obverse


Obverse description : Écu couronné aux armes de Blois tenu par un chien et un hérisson dressés ; signature BARRE - FECIT au dessous.

Reverse


Reverse legend : SOCIETE ACADEMIQUE DE BLOIS.
Reverse description : Couronne formée d’une branche d’olivier et d’une branche de laurier.

Historical background


BLOIS AND THE BLAISOIS - GENTRY AND TOWNS

The town of Blois was in the 9th century, the seat of the county of Robert le Fort. Thibaut de Chartres seized it during the reign of Charles the Simple and the county remained with his descendants until 1391, when the county was sold to Louis I of France, Duke of Orléans. His grandson, Louis XII, ascending the throne, unites the county to the Crown. Favorite residence of the Valois, its castle was rebuilt and enlarged during the 16th and 17th centuries. The States-General were held there in 1576 and 1588, famous for the assassination of the Duke of Guise. The government took refuge there in 1814. Blois is today the capital of the department of Loir-et-Cher.
